Overview Medlone 8 Tablet

Medlone 8 tablets offer broad-spectrum treatment for diverse conditions, including severe allergies, asthma, rheumatic illnesses, dermatological and ophthalmological issues, and systemic lupus erythematosus. Its mechanism involves suppressing inflammation-inducing substances, providing symptomatic relief. Administer Medlone 8 tablets with food to minimize gastrointestinal discomfort. Dosage and treatment duration are condition-specific; adhere strictly to prescribed regimens. Avoid exceeding recommended doses or frequency; consistent use is crucial, as premature cessation may exacerbate underlying conditions. Potential side effects include epidermal thinning, heightened infection susceptibility, decreased bone mineral density, and altered mood. Consult your physician if these effects persist or worsen; management strategies may be available. Given its immunosuppressant properties, minimize contact with individuals exhibiting contagious illnesses like measles, chickenpox, or influenza.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any pre-existing conditions such as osteoporosis, mood disorders, hypertension, or hepatic impairment. Diabetics should also disclose their condition, as Medlone 8 may elevate blood glucose levels, potentially exacerbating diabetes. Comprehensive disclosure of all concurrent medications is essential to ensure medication compatibility and safety. Furthermore, disclose any pregnancy, pregnancy plans, or breastfeeding.

How Medlone 8 Tablet works:

Medlone 8 Tablet, a corticosteroid medication, inhibits the synthesis of specific inflammatory mediators, thereby alleviating symptoms associated with redness, swelling, and allergic reactions.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Medlone 8 Tablet and alcohol should not be consumed together.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Medlone 8 Tablet during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ers prior to prescription.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on Medlone 8 Tablet use while breastfeeding is l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Medlone 8 Tablet may result in side effects that impair driving. These potential adverse reactions include dizziness, vertigo, blurred vision, and tiredness, potentially affecting your ability to operate a vehicle.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Medlone 8 Tablet poses no safety concerns for individuals with kidney disease, and dose modification is unnecessary. Nevertheless, consult your physician regarding any pre-existing kidney conditions.

LiverLi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Insufficient data exists regarding Medlone 8 Tablet's use in individuals with hepatic impairment.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Medlone 8 Tablet :

Should you forget a Medlone 8 Tablet dose, take it immediately. If, however, your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
